What Is an Apostille, and Why Do You Need It?
An apostille is an official certification that verifies the authenticity of a document, making it legally valid for use in other countries that are signatories to the Hague Convention of 1961. When you need to use an American document abroad—such as a birth certificate, marriage license, or a power of attorney—you will likely need to have it apostilled to ensure that foreign authorities accept it.
While many countries accept documents without the need for an apostille, others have strict requirements that mandate this authentication. Some common reasons you may need an apostille include:
• Immigration and Visa Applications: Countries such as Canada, Australia, and the European Union often require apostilled documents as part of visa and immigration processes.
• Business Purposes: If you’re conducting business abroad or dealing with international contracts, an apostille may be required for business documents like articles of incorporation or company bylaws.
• Personal Matters: Apostilles are commonly required for documents related to adoption, marriage, or divorce in international legal processes.

Why Do You Need Notary Services?
Notary services are essential for ensuring that important documents are signed and verified in the presence of a legally authorized witness. A notary public serves as a neutral third party, confirming the identity of the signer, witnessing the signature, and ensuring the signer is doing so voluntarily and under no duress.
You may need notary services for a variety of documents, including:
• Contracts and Agreements: For business, legal, or personal agreements, a notary provides assurance that the document is legitimate and that all parties have signed it willingly.
• Wills and Trusts: Notarization is often required for wills, living trusts, and power of attorney documents to ensure their validity.
• Real Estate Documents: Documents related to property transactions, such as deeds and titles, often require notarization to be legally binding.
• Affidavits and Sworn Statements: Sworn documents and declarations also require a notary’s presence to authenticate the signatures.
